| Summary: | Biopsy were taken from 50 patients in order to cultivate Helicobacter pylori and
blood samples to detect anemia , differential white blood eellcount and blood groups .
The results showed that anemia was found in 48% of the patients while lymphocyte
elevated in 44% of them , blood group 0 had the higher percentage ( 42% ) in those
patients among the other blood group types" . ' . _ _
INTRODUCTION -
Helicobacter pylori is a gram-negative microorganism that secretes many
substances including ammoina , mucolytic enzymes ( adhesins , catalase and urease ) and
acid secrete inhibitory proteins.(8) In addition to that it secrets toxin like vacuolating
cytotoxin A (vacA).(7). - —
Adhesin allows the organism to adhere , catalase might protect the organisum from
the immune system , urease increase the secretion of gastrin which stimulate the intestinal‘
tissues to grow faster , and so could result in increased cancer risk .Urease is reponsible for
hydrolyzing urea to NH3 and CO2, and acts as also protective by forming an alkalin
environment around the organism . The combination of NH3 ,_Co2 and inhibitory proteins
allows the bacteria to setup locallized pockets where it can neutralize even the acidity of

The genetics of the secretor and non —-secretor system interact to alter an
individuals risk for ulcer. In several studies , non—secretors of ABO substances have been
found to have significantly higher rate ofduodenal and peplic ulcer .( 8)
fl._ pylori infection increases the percentage of peripheral lymphocytes above the
upper limit of referential.values .(l0)e ' ‘
Recent evidence suggests that fl_. pylori infection could cause iron deficiency
anemia ( IDA ).(2). Adolescent femal athletes may have development of [_{_.__pylori
associated ( IDA ) which can be managed by Q pylori eradication (5 ) . H. pylori may
have a role in causing IDA in school-age children (3 ) |
